Peter Andreas Thiel ( / tiːl /; born 11 October 1967) is an American entrepreneur, venture capitalist, and political activist. [1] [2] [3] A co-founder of PayPal, Palantir Technologies, and Founders Fund, he was the first outside investor in Facebook.

  2. May 14, 2024 · Peter Thiel (born October 11, 1967, Frankfurt am Main, West Germany) is a German American entrepreneur, venture capitalist and business executive who helped found PayPal, an e-commerce company, and Palantir Technologies, a software firm involved in data analysis.
